Error messages and troubleshooting

Possible Error Messages (Main Unit)

The gigabeat may display the following error messages. Take appropriate action by
referring to the instructions below.
Message
UNSUPPORTED DATA
UNABLE TO READ DISK
NO DATA FOUND
DATA ERROR
FAILED TO OPEN
RECHARGE BATTERY
NO SYSTEM FOUND ON
HDD
Content and Corrective Action
The format of the selected data cannot be played on
the gigabeat. Use gigabeat room to transfer the data.
Reformat the built-in hard disk to the FAT32 format.
Use the gigabeat format.
Transferring tracks to the gigabeat.
The selected data is damaged. Use gigabeat room to
transfer the data.
The track could not be opened and played.
Use gigabeat room to transfer the data.
There is insufficient power remaining in the built-in
battery. Connect the AC adapter and charge the
battery.
The gigabeat cannot be started because the firmware
on the hard disk has been destroyed.
Restore the firmware.
